Workshop for job searching skills
In the premises of the Employment Agency of Montenegro in Podgorica on June 18th 2020, a workshop on building up the necessary skills for finding a job after finishing high school was held for high school students from the Roma community.
The workshop was led by a psychologist and counselor at the Labor Office, and the topics which they have covered were: applying to the Labor Office and searching for a job after finishing high school, professional orientation for those who want to enroll in college, and the correct behavior at a job interview.
Sultan Beca: Helping the community is priceless
One of the most important links as it is necessary to fulfill the chain of tasks in the field of education is the mediator. The one assigned this very demanding role provides support to children, parents, and teachers. He cooperates, talks, actively influences, balances, and „jumps in“ when it is needed most.
In this demanding job, someone you can rely on is Sultan Beca from Berane. He is a facilitator in the ROMACTED programme for the Berane Municipality, and an associate in the field of social inclusion in education. At the Elementary School Radomir Mitrovic, he and his colleague Petrit Amurllahu take care of 140 children. The goal is that elementary school students stay in school, attend classes regularly, and continue their education. Beća lives in the settlement Riverside, which shares its name with the famous city of California. Besides the name, they have something else in common – population density. It's just that Riverside in Berane, unlike the one in America, doesn't have such good tempting conditions. We talked with Sultan about the opportunities for the RE community in Berane, the housing, the health field that needs special attention, and the current situation of the RE community in the field of education in the Riverside and Talum settlements.
How is he coping? This humble and dedicated young man, who does not stop doing good deeds, told us is the burden too heavy and what are the ways for RE children and adults to break free and show their full potential. The information he presented to us is worrying.
